Actual motor current may be higher or lower than typical values shown below. IN ALL CASES, the current shown on the motor nameplate is the correct value for that particular motor and takes precedence over any value shown in this table. For reliable motor protection use the actual motor current (FLA - Full Load Amps) listed on the motor nameplate.
The values shown below are typical for motors running at standard speeds with normal torque characteristics. Motors built for high efficiency, low speeds, high torques, multi-speeds or other special applications may have different Full Load Amps than what is shown in the table. In these cases, the motor nameplate FLA rating must be used. |

| The information in this table was derived from Table 430-148 & 430-150 of the NEC and Table 45.2 of the UL Industrial Control Standard 508. The voltages listed are standard rated motor voltages. The currents listed shall be permitted for system voltage ranges of 110-120, 220-240, 440-480, and 550-600 volts. |
